6. (B) Program for numerical integration using Simpson’s 1/3
rd
rule.
| ||
| x=(a:h:b); | ||
| y=f(x); | ||
| m=length(y); | ||
| i=y(1)+y(m); | ||
| for j=2:m-1; | ||
| if(modulo(j,2)==0)then | ||
| i=i+4*y(j); | ||
| else | ||
| i=i+2*y(j); | ||
| end; | ||
| end; | ||
| i=(h/3)*i; | ||
| return(i); | ||
| endfunction | ||
| deff('[y]=f(x)','y=exp(x)') | ||
| simpsons13(0,4,4,f) | ||
